📝 What to Check Before Renting
Here are key factors you should verify so the rental goes smoothly:
1. Licence & Eligibility
- Make sure your riding licence category is valid in NSW (Australia) for the bike size you want.
- If you hold an overseas licence, check if it’s accepted or you might need an International Driving Permit.
- Some rental places note “LAMS approved bikes” (Learner Approved Motorcycle Scheme) for certain smaller bikes.
2. Cost & What’s Included
- Make sure what you are paying includes: fuel policy, mileage (some say unlimited kilometres)
- Check what extras you might pay: helmet, gear, deposit, drop-off/pick-up.
- Insurance: Make sure comprehensive insurance + roadside assistance are included or clarified – a breakdown mid-ride is not fun.
3. Bike Condition & Suitability
- Inspect the bike for obvious damage before you ride.
- Choose a bike size that suits your experience: If you’re newer to riding, a smaller displacement might be safer & more comfortable.
- If you plan to ride out of the city (e.g., into the countryside), pick a bike suited to longer rides.
4. Rules & Local Traffic Laws
- Familiarise yourself with NSW road rules for motorcycles (lane filtering, speed limits, helmet laws).
- Parking: Look into motorcycle parking rules in the area you’ll ride/stay. Some councils have special motorcycle parking.
- Tolls: If you use toll roads, check whether the rental includes toll pass or you’ll pay separately.
- Fuel: Check if the bike comes with full tank and whether you should return it full.
5. Duration & Drop-off Options
- Decide how long you need it (daily, weekly, multi-week). Some rentals give discounts for longer periods. (motohire.com.au)
- Ask about pick-up & drop-off locations: is it one-way permitted, is there a fee?
- If you plan a tour/ride outside Sydney, ask if they allow that and any restrictions (distance, geography, timing).
